It was a great morning to celebrate our Veterans! Thank you Dale Doerhoff for being our guest speaker. We learned all about the history of those who served from our area and about the Veterans Memorial. Thank you to all the Veterans who attended our ceremony. We appreciate you and thank you for your service! ❤️🤍💙🇺🇸 Thank you to Mrs. Holtmeyer and her business class for the slideshow, programs, and all your work to plan for the ceremony. Thank you Mr. Breeding and the band for the music for the ceremony.
